/ Forside / Teknologi / Udvikling / HTML /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
HTML
#NavnPoint
molokyle 11184
Klaudi 5506
bentjuul 3377
severino 2040
smorch 1950
strarup 1525
natmaden 1396
scootergr.. 1320
e.c 1150
10  miritdk 1110
Grundlæggende CSS-spørgsmål
Fra : Marianne


Dato : 28-12-01 17:35

Hej

Der er et eller andet grundlæggende, jeg ikke kan finde ud af med CSS. Er
der en, der gider forklare ?

Jeg bruger et externt stylesheet.
Har brug for 2 forskellige typer links (altså to forskellige sæt udseender).

Jeg kan jo godt finde ud af at definere den ene sæt vha a:links, a:visited
osv. Men hvordan gør jeg ved det andet ? Definerer jeg så dette lokalt -
eller hvad ?

Tilsvarende med punktopstillinger (problemet er sikkert det samme). Jeg har
brug for flere forskellige slags - men der er jo kun een UL at gøre med.

????

mvh

Marianne



 
 
Knud Gert Ellentoft (28-12-2001)
Kommentar
Fra : Knud Gert Ellentoft


Dato : 28-12-01 17:44

Fri, 28 Dec 2001 17:34:34 +0100, skrev "Marianne"
<hoyen@lundbak.dk>:

>Jeg kan jo godt finde ud af at definere den ene sæt vha a:links, a:visited
>osv. Men hvordan gør jeg ved det andet ? Definerer jeg så dette lokalt -
>eller hvad ?

Bruger class til det, der skal være anderledes.

I style sheet:

a.anderledes:link   {......}
a.anderledes:visited {......}

og på siden
<a class="anderledes" href="...>

Classnavnet kan være hvad som helst i et ord (uden æøå)

>Tilsvarende med punktopstillinger (problemet er sikkert det samme). Jeg har
>brug for flere forskellige slags - men der er jo kun een UL at gøre med.

Ja, det gøres på samme måde med class.

--
med venlig hilsen
Knud
http://home13.inet.tele.dk/smedpark/

Marianne (28-12-2001)
Kommentar
Fra : Marianne


Dato : 28-12-01 22:04

Tusind tak - det hjalp en del, men desværre ikke helt.

Er der en, der gider tage et kig på http://www.hoyen.dk/test/laerselv.htm og
fortælle, hvorfor h...... det ikke du'r ?

På forhånd tak

Marianne



Knud Gert Ellentoft (28-12-2001)
Kommentar
Fra : Knud Gert Ellentoft


Dato : 28-12-01 22:21

Fri, 28 Dec 2001 22:03:43 +0100, skrev "Marianne"
<hoyen@lundbak.dk>:

>Er der en, der gider tage et kig på http://www.hoyen.dk/test/laerselv.htm og
>fortælle, hvorfor h...... det ikke du'r ?

Grunden til at det ikke virker er, at det skal stå i en bestemt
rækkefølge og du har brugt . istedet for :

Du bruger:
a.link
a.active
a.visited
a.hover

Det skal være:
a:link
a:visited
a:hover
a:active

--
med venlig hilsen
Knud
http://home13.inet.tele.dk/smedpark/

Marianne (28-12-2001)
Kommentar
Fra : Marianne


Dato : 28-12-01 22:46

> Grunden til at det ikke virker er, at det skal stå i en bestemt
> rækkefølge og du har brugt . istedet for :
>
> Du bruger:
> a.link
> a.active
> a.visited
> a.hover
>
> Det skal være:
> a:link
> a:visited
> a:hover
> a:active

Pr. aktion sådan at der kommer til at stå

a.link
a.menu.link
a.visited
a.menu:visited

eller pr. class ?

OK - jeg prøver selv.

Igen mange tak for hjælpen

mvh
Marianne



Marianne (28-12-2001)
Kommentar
Fra : Marianne


Dato : 28-12-01 22:54

> Grunden til at det ikke virker er, at det skal stå i en bestemt
> rækkefølge og du har brugt . istedet for :
>
> Du bruger:
> a.link
> a.active
> a.visited
> a.hover
>
> Det skal være:
> a:link
> a:visited
> a:hover
> a:active

Nu har jeg prøvet at ændre ... det går fint med den første del af
definitionen, men hover kan jeg ikke få til at du' i den sidste ? Har jeg
overset mere ? Den rettede er på http://www.hoyen.dk/test/laerselv.htm

mvh
Marianne



Knud Gert Ellentoft (28-12-2001)
Kommentar
Fra : Knud Gert Ellentoft


Dato : 28-12-01 23:05

Fri, 28 Dec 2001 22:53:38 +0100, skrev "Marianne"
<hoyen@lundbak.dk>:

>Nu har jeg prøvet at ændre ... det går fint med den første del af
>definitionen, men hover kan jeg ikke få til at du' i den sidste ?

Du har ikke ændret . til :

Fra din css:
a.link { color: blue }
a.visited { color: red }
a.hover { color: purple; font-style: italic }
a.active    { color: green }

Skal være:

a:link { color: blue }
a:visited { color: red }
a:hover { color: purple; font-style: italic }
a:active    { color: green }
--
med venlig hilsen
Knud
http://home13.inet.tele.dk/smedpark/

Marianne (28-12-2001)
Kommentar
Fra : Marianne


Dato : 28-12-01 23:55

>
> Du har ikke ændret . til :

Åhhh - det var for småt til, at jeg fik øje på det. Tak.

mvh
marianne



scn (28-12-2001)
Kommentar
Fra : scn


Dato : 28-12-01 17:56


"Marianne" <hoyen@lundbak.dk> skrev i en meddelelse news:3c2c9f74$0$55603$edfadb0f@dspool01.news.tele.dk...
> Hej
>
> Der er et eller andet grundlæggende, jeg ikke kan finde ud af med CSS. Er
> der en, der gider forklare ?
>
> Jeg bruger et externt stylesheet.
> Har brug for 2 forskellige typer links (altså to forskellige sæt udseender).
>
> Jeg kan jo godt finde ud af at definere den ene sæt vha a:links, a:visited
> osv. Men hvordan gør jeg ved det andet ? Definerer jeg så dette lokalt -
> eller hvad ?
>
Ved ikke om det er dette:
Brug class

eks:

html-fil (udsnit):
<A class="menu1" href="fil1.htm">menu1</A>
<A class="menu2" href="fil2.htm">menu2</A>


css-fil:
A.menu1 {
font-size:1.0em;
}
A.menu2 {
font-size:2.0em;
}

håber det hjælper


> Tilsvarende med punktopstillinger (problemet er sikkert det samme). Jeg har
> brug for flere forskellige slags - men der er jo kun een UL at gøre med.
>
kan måske løses på sammemåde


mvh Søren


Søg
Reklame
Statistik
Spørgsmål : 177557
Tips : 31968
Nyheder : 719565
Indlæg : 6408877
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ste